Understanding Juvenile Crimes in Florida

The juvenile justice system in Florida is designed to rehabilitate rather than punish minors. However, some offenses can lead to severe penalties, particularly if the minor is charged as an adult. Common juvenile offenses include:

  • Underage Drinking and DUI: Driving under the influence or possessing alcohol while under the legal drinking age.
  • Drug Possession: Possession of marijuana, controlled substances, or drug paraphernalia.
  • Theft: Shoplifting, burglary, or other theft-related crimes.
  • Assault and Battery: Physical altercations or threatening harm to another person.
  • Vandalism: Damage to property, such as graffiti or destruction of public or private property.
  • Cybercrimes: Hacking, online bullying, or identity theft.

Potential Consequences for Juvenile Offenses

Although juvenile cases are handled differently from adult cases, the penalties can still be significant and life-altering. Potential consequences include:

  • Probation or community service.
  • Mandatory counseling or participation in rehabilitation programs.
  • Fines and restitution payments.
  • Detention in a juvenile facility.
  • Expulsion or suspension from school.
  • Permanent criminal record if charged as an adult.

In some cases, prosecutors may seek to try a minor as an adult, depending on the severity of the offense and the minor’s age. This can result in harsher penalties and a permanent criminal record.
